What Industries Use High Speed Spindles
Industrial mould, tool, and die makers depend on for precision and efficiency. The accuracy and quick material removal rates match the precise details and flawless surface requirements of these industries. They also enable micro-machining. Due to stringent tolerances and lightweight designs, aerospace component manufacturing relies significantly on high speed spindles. These spindles provide the accuracy and speed needed to make turbine blades and structural elements with geometric precision.
There are also necessary for specific applications where conventional tools fail. Friction stir welding uses their stability and advanced control to combine materials without compromising structural integrity. Testing bench arrangements imitate real-world operating conditions to assess performance and durability are another unique use. High speed spindles ensure consistent outputs throughout varied testing settings because to their precision and versatility. In research and development, their capacity to maintain high speeds under varied conditions is important. The adaptability of these spindles makes them ideal for specialized industrial jobs and cutting-edge innovation.
